It’s official - Pā Reo is a certified Living Building Challenge® Full Living project!

Designed by Tennent Brown Architects and part of Te Wānanga o Ruakawa campus in Ōtaki, Pā Reo has passed the certification process to become a sustainable, self-sufficient building under the ultra-strict and world-leading Living Building Challenge® Full Living certification using Living Building Challenge® v.4.0 through Living Future, meeting all 7 Petals and 20 Imperatives.

Pā Reo is part of a very small global club - one of just 38 buildings in the world, and only the second commercial building in Aotearoa, to achieve this qualification. When they call it a challenge they aren’t wrong… it means these extra special buildings have their own on-site water collection and waste treatment plant, generates all its own power, is built solely from meticulously-tested, low-chemical materials to support carbon neutrality, and so much more.

Together with Rawiri Richmond and all the incredible people at Te Wānanga o Raukawa, Architects Ewan Brown, Hugh Tennent and the Tennent Brown team have been dedicated to the vision at every step. With the wellbeing of people and the environment at its heart, Pā Reo is a beacon and a blueprint for the future of sustainable design. Thank you to everyone who has joined us on the journey!
